Shrimp Boil

Cultural Context

Originating from the coastal regions of the United States, particularly the Lowcountry of South Carolina, the Shrimp Boil is a festive dish that brings together fresh seafood, vegetables, and spices. Traditionally enjoyed at gatherings and celebrations, it reflects the communal spirit of Southern cooking. Today, variations can be found across the country, often featuring different seafood or seasonings to suit local tastes.

1

Add 5 quarts of water to a large pot.

2

Add 2 tablespoons of salt, 1 onion, 1 lemon, and 1 bag of shrimp and crab boil concentrate to the pot.

3

Bring the water to a boil.

4

Add corn to the boiling water and cook for 10 minutes.

5

Add potatoes to the pot and cook for 15 minutes or until tender.

6

Remove corn and potatoes from the pot, reserving 1.5 cups of the broth.

7

In a skillet, cook sausage for about 5 minutes and then remove it from the skillet.

8

Melt 2 lbs of butter in the skillet over medium heat and skim the top layer of the butter.

9

Add 3 heads of minced garlic to the butter and cook for 30 seconds.

10

Add spices: paprika, lemon pepper, Cayenne, Old Bay seasoning, Cajun seasoning, onion powder, and brown sugar to the butter mixture and mix well.

11

Squeeze the juice of 1 lemon into the mixture and add the reserved broth, allowing it to come to a simmer.

12

Add 5 lbs of colossal shrimp to the simmering mixture and cook for 3 to 4 minutes.

13

Boil crab legs in a separate pot for 4 minutes.

14

Combine the shrimp and crab legs with the corn and potatoes in the pot and mix everything together.
